Avoid These Common Editorial Mistakes

Incorrect equipment weight ratings

Ground support equipment failure and potential aircraft structural damage during loading or pushback operations

Ambiguous marshalling signals

Aircraft positioning errors leading to ground collisions, equipment damage, or runway incursions

Inaccurate fuel system specifications

Fuel contamination, improper fuel loads, or equipment damage during aircraft servicing operations

Missing safety clearance distances

Personnel injuries, equipment collisions, or foreign object debris incidents on airport ramps

Wrong electrical connection procedures

Aircraft electrical system damage, ground power unit failures, or personnel electrocution hazards

Frequently Asked Questions

How technical should our ground support candidates' writing abilities be?
Candidates need precision with equipment specifications, safety procedures, and technical measurements. They should demonstrate familiarity with hydraulic systems, electrical requirements, and aircraft interface protocols while maintaining clarity for operational personnel.
What's the biggest language risk when hiring ground support documentation staff?
Equipment specification errors pose the greatest risk, potentially causing aircraft damage or safety incidents. Candidates must distinguish between similar equipment types and accurately document technical parameters under time pressure.
Should we test for knowledge of specific ground support equipment manufacturers?
Focus on generic equipment categories and safety principles rather than specific brands. However, candidates should understand standard industry terminology for pushback tractors, ground power units, and cargo handling equipment across manufacturers.
How important is speed versus accuracy for ground support documentation roles?
Accuracy is paramount due to safety implications, but candidates must work efficiently in fast-paced airport environments. Test for both precision in technical details and ability to produce clear, concise documentation quickly.
What regulatory knowledge should ground support writers demonstrate?
Candidates should show familiarity with IATA ground handling standards, FAA safety regulations, and manufacturer specifications. However, focus testing on their ability to accurately interpret and communicate technical requirements rather than memorizing specific regulations.
